解锁网络边界:华硕路由器上部署Clash的全方位效能指南

看看资讯 / 1人浏览

在当今数字时代,网络不仅是信息通道,更是效率与自由的关键。地理限制、隐私泄露、速度瓶颈——这些常见问题困扰着无数用户。而将高性能的华硕路由器与强大的代理工具Clash相结合,正成为破解这些难题的优雅方案。本指南将深入解析如何通过这一组合,彻底提升你的网络效率与安全性,打造一个既快速又私密的家庭或办公网络环境。

华硕路由器:稳定网络的基石

华硕路由器凭借其卓越的硬件性能、稳定的固件支持以及丰富的扩展功能,在市场上赢得了广泛赞誉。无论是面向游戏优化的ROG系列,还是注重全屋覆盖的AiMesh系统,华硕路由器都提供了高度可靠的基础网络架构。其内置的ASUSWRT管理界面直观易用,同时开放了诸如SSH访问、自定义脚本安装等高级功能,这为部署第三方应用如Clash提供了坚实的平台。选择华硕路由器,意味着你选择了一个强大且可深度定制的网络控制中心。

Clash:智能代理的核心引擎

Clash是一款开源、跨平台的网络代理工具,其设计理念侧重于规则驱动的流量转发。与简单VPN不同,Clash支持多种代理协议(如SS、VMess、Trojan等),并允许用户通过精细的规则设置(基于域名、IP、地理信息等),实现智能分流。例如,国内流量直连以保证速度,国际流量则通过代理节点访问以突破限制。这种灵活性使得Clash不仅是“翻墙”工具,更是优化整体网络体验、增强隐私保护的智能网络层。

为何要在华硕路由器上部署Clash?

将Clash部署在路由器层面,而非单个设备,具有颠覆性的优势:

  1. 全局覆盖,一劳永逸:一旦在路由器上配置成功,连接到该路由器的所有设备(电脑、手机、平板、智能电视等)无需单独设置,即可自动享受代理服务,实现全家科学上网。
  2. 性能释放,硬件加速:华硕路由器通常配备较强的CPU和硬件NAT加速,由路由器处理加密解密和流量转发,可以减轻终端设备的负担,尤其有利于智能电视、游戏主机等不易安装客户端设备的性能表现。
  3. 隐私保护的统一防线:所有外发流量在源头(路由器)即被加密处理,为整个局域网提供了统一的隐私保护屏障,有效防止本地网络监听和数据泄露。
  4. 网络管理集中化:通过路由器的管理界面,可以集中监控流量、切换节点、更新规则,管理效率远高于在多个设备上分别操作。

详尽配置步骤:从零到精通

前期准备:固件与文件

  1. 确认路由器型号与固件:确保你的华硕路由器型号支持第三方软件安装。强烈建议将官方固件升级至最新版本,或根据社区推荐,刷入如梅林(Merlin)固件。梅林固件在保留官方稳定性的同时,开放了更多高级功能,对Clash的支持通常更友好。
  2. 获取Clash核心文件:访问Clash的GitHub发布页,根据你路由器的CPU架构(常见如armv7、armv8等)下载对应的Clash核心二进制文件(如clash-linux-armv8)。同时,准备好你的代理服务提供商提供的配置文件(.yaml格式)国家/地区地理信息数据库(Country.mmdb)

核心安装与配置流程

步骤一:登录并开启路由器高级功能 通过浏览器登录华硕路由器管理后台(通常地址为192.168.1.1,账号密码默认为admin/admin)。在“系统管理”或“高级设置”中,开启SSH访问(如LAN Only)。使用SSH客户端(如PuTTY、Termius)连接到路由器。

步骤二:部署Clash核心与资源文件 通过SSH,使用命令行将下载好的Clash核心文件、配置文件(config.yaml)和Country.mmdb文件上传至路由器合适的目录,例如/jffs/clash/。并为Clash核心文件添加可执行权限。 bash chmod +x /jffs/clash/clash-linux-armv8

步骤三:创建自定义启动脚本 为了确保Clash在路由器重启后能自动运行,需要在路由器自定义脚本功能中配置。在管理界面的“高级设置” -> “自定义脚本”中,找到“防火墙启动后”或“WAN启动后”的脚本区域,添加启动命令。 ```bash

!/bin/sh

/jffs/clash/clash-linux-armv8 -d /jffs/clash & ``` 此脚本会在网络就绪后自动启动Clash,并指定配置目录。

步骤四:配置透明代理与流量分流(关键) 这是实现全局代理的核心。需要通过修改路由器的防火墙规则,将局域网设备的流量定向到Clash监听的端口。这通常需要在“自定义脚本”的“防火墙规则”部分添加iptables命令。例如: bash iptables -t nat -A PREROUTING -p tcp -d 192.168.1.0/24 -j REDIRECT --to-ports 7892 (注:此为例示,具体规则需根据Clash配置文件中redir-port设置和你的局域网网段进行精细调整,以实现国内外流量分流,避免国内访问变慢。)

步骤五:配置Clash配置文件 用文本编辑器仔细编辑你的config.yaml文件。关键部分包括: - portsocks-port:管理端口。 - redir-port:透明代理端口(与上述iptables规则对应)。 - mode:规则模式,推荐使用rule(规则模式)或global(全局模式)。 - proxies:填入你的代理服务器节点信息。 - proxy-groups:定义节点选择策略(如自动测速、故障转移等)。 - rules:这是分流规则的灵魂,需精心设置,确保DOMAIN-SUFFIX,google.com,Proxy(谷歌走代理)、GEOIP,CN,DIRECT(中国IP直连)等规则准确无误。

步骤六:启动、测试与优化 保存所有配置并重启路由器,或通过SSH手动启动Clash。在浏览器中访问Clash的管理面板(通常为http://路由器IP:9090/ui),检查代理节点连接状态和规则加载情况。使用设备访问ip.sbipleak.net等网站,检查IP地址是否已变为代理服务器地址,并测试国内外网站的访问速度。

深度优化与高级技巧

  • 性能调优:在Clash配置中启用tun模式(需要内核支持)或混合模式,可以获得更好的兼容性和性能。合理设置dns部分,使用fallbacknameserver策略,能极大提升域名解析速度。
  • 规则维护:订阅高质量的规则集链接,而非手动维护,可以让规则自动更新,应对不断变化的网络环境。
  • 资源监控:通过路由器的系统监控或Clash面板,关注CPU和内存占用。对于性能较弱的路由器,可考虑关闭日志、减少规则条目以节省资源。
  • 安全加固:定期更新Clash核心版本以修复漏洞。在配置文件中设置强密码保护管理界面和API。

常见问题与解决方案

  1. 连接速度不理想:首先在Clash面板内测试不同节点的延迟和速度,切换至最优节点。检查是否为路由器性能瓶颈,或尝试在配置中切换代理协议(如从SS改为Trojan)。
  2. 部分设备或应用无法代理:检查Clash的分流规则是否覆盖了该应用使用的域名或IP。对于游戏主机等,可能需要设置DMZ或手动配置代理。
  3. 路由器运行不稳定:可能是内存不足。尝试为路由器添加虚拟内存(Swap),或精简Clash配置。确保路由器通风良好,避免过热。
  4. 国内网站访问变慢:这是分流规则不准确导致的。确保GEOIP,CN,DIRECT规则位置靠前且有效,并订阅包含国内直连列表的规则集。

精彩点评:技术赋能下的网络自主权

将Clash部署于华硕路由器之上,远不止是一项技术操作,它更象征着用户对自身网络自主权的 reclaim。在由硬件(华硕的稳定与性能)与软件(Clash的智能与灵活)共同构建的这座私人数字桥梁上,地理的隔阂被消弭,信息的流动回归其本质上的自由与高效。它把复杂的代理逻辑从终端设备中抽象出来,下沉到网络基础设施层,从而提供了一种无缝、统一且强大的增强体验。

这一方案的精妙之处在于其“润物细无声”的融合。用户无需在每个设备上操心开关与设置,整个网络环境已然被优化。这正体现了现代科技的最高追求:将复杂留给自己,将简洁、强大与自由留给用户。华硕路由器提供的可靠平台与Clash带来的智能代理能力,共同编织了一张既广阔无界又安全私密的个人互联网,这不仅是网络效率的提升,更是数字生活品质的一次飞跃。

通过本指南的实践,你不仅获得了一个更快的网络,更掌握了一把开启全球数字宝藏的钥匙,并在自家网络的入口处,筑起了一道坚固的隐私防线。这,便是技术赋能带来的真正力量。

校园网络自由之门:Clash详细配置指南与深度体验

在数字化浪潮席卷教育的今天,校园网如同学术血脉,连接着知识库与求知者。然而,这道桥梁有时却设有限制——国际学术站点加载缓慢,外部学习资源访问受阻,跨地域协作平台连接不稳。正是在这样的背景下,Clash作为一款智能代理工具,悄然成为许多师生突破网络边界、提升学习效率的利器。它并非简单的“翻墙”软件,而是一个高度可定制、规则驱动的网络流量管理平台,能够根据用户需求智能分流,让校园网既保持内部高速,又畅通外部连接。本文将带你从零开始,全面掌握Clash在校园环境中的部署、配置与优化,并分享其背后的使用哲学。

一、理解Clash:不只是工具,更是网络策略

Clash诞生于开源社区,其核心设计理念是“规则至上”。与传统VPN不同,它允许用户通过YAML配置文件精细控制每一条网络请求——哪些流量直连校园内网、哪些经由代理访问外网、哪些被完全屏蔽。这种设计尤其适合校园场景:学生既需要快速访问校内选课系统、图书馆数据库,又希望无缝查阅Google Scholar、GitHub或观看海外公开课。Clash的多协议支持(如SS、VMess、Trojan等)使其能适应各种代理服务,而本地DNS劫持防护和流量加密功能,则增添了安全层。

在校园中使用Clash,本质是在不破坏校园网原有架构的前提下,为自己开辟一条智能通道。它避免了全局代理导致的校内资源访问减速,也解决了手动切换代理的繁琐。更重要的是,Clash的日志系统和流量监控,能让用户清晰了解网络行为,培养良好的数字素养。

二、前期准备:心态与环境的双重构建

在下载软件前,需明确两点:一是目的,二是责任。使用Clach应服务于学习研究、信息获取等正当需求,而非规避正当网络监管;同时要了解所在学校的网络使用政策,避免违规。技术上,请确保你拥有管理员权限的电脑(校园公共机房可能限制安装),并备份重要数据。

三、软件安装:跨平台的无缝部署

3.1 获取官方版本

Clash核心是开源项目,但普通用户更常使用其图形化衍生版本(如Clash for Windows、ClashX for Mac)。务必从GitHub官方仓库或可信渠道下载,避免第三方修改版本的安全风险。

  • Windows平台:访问GitHub仓库发布页,下载后缀为.exe的安装包。建议选择标有“latest”的稳定版。
  • macOS平台:可通过Homebrew命令brew install clash安装核心,或直接下载ClashX等图形界面客户端。
  • Linux平台:在终端执行相应架构的安装命令,例如基于Debian的系统可使用sudo apt-get install clash

3.2 安装与初次启动

安装过程与常规软件无异,但启动后你可能会发现界面简洁得近乎“空白”——这是因为Clash的一切能力都等待配置文件来激活。此时不妨先熟悉界面布局:通常有“代理”、“规则”、“连接”、“日志”等标签页,它们将是未来你调控网络的指挥台。

四、核心配置:从零编写你的网络地图

4.1 配置文件的本质

Clash的配置文件(通常命名为config.yaml)是一个YAML格式的文本文件,它定义了代理节点、路由规则、DNS策略等所有行为。你可以将其理解为一张“网络交通图”:数据包如同车辆,根据目的地(域名或IP)被分流到不同的道路(直连或代理)。

4.2 获取与修改配置文件

对于新手,最快捷的方式是从可信的社区论坛或学术社群获取基础配置文件。但强烈建议逐步学习自行编写,因为只有自己才最清楚需求。用文本编辑器(如VS Code、Notepad++)打开配置文件,你会看到几个关键部分:

  • proxies:在此填入你的代理服务器信息。格式如下: ```yaml proxies:
    • name: "学术节点" type: ss server: university.proxy.example port: 443 cipher: aes-256-gcm password: "your_password" ```
  • proxy-groups:将代理节点分组,实现负载均衡或自动选择。例如: ```yaml proxy-groups:
    • name: "智能选择" type: url-test proxies: ["学术节点", "备用节点"] url: "http://www.gstatic.com/generate_204" interval: 300 ```
  • rules:这是Clash的灵魂。规则按顺序匹配,决定流量去向。校园网典型配置可能包含: ```yaml rules:
    • DOMAIN-SUFFIX,library.edu.cn,DIRECT # 校内图书馆直连
    • DOMAIN-KEYWORD,google,智能选择 # 谷歌服务走代理
    • GEOIP,CN,DIRECT # 中国大陆IP直连
    • MATCH,智能选择 # 其余流量智能分流 ```

4.3 配置校园网特化规则

针对校园环境,建议优先保障校内资源访问速度: 1. 将学校官网、教务系统、知网等国内学术站点设为DIRECT。 2. 将需要加速的海外学术资源(如IEEE、SpringerLink)指向低延迟节点。 3. 利用DOMAIN-SUFFIX规则批量处理学校域名(如.edu.cn)。 4. 可导入GFWList社区规则作为基础,再在其上添加校园特化规则。

五、高级技巧:让Clash融入学习日常

5.1 规则组的妙用

创建多个规则组应对不同场景:“学习模式”优先稳定连接学术数据库,“娱乐模式”可包含流媒体节点,“节能模式”则限制代理流量。通过Clash的快捷切换功能,一键改变网络策略。

5.2 利用脚本增强功能

Clash支持JavaScript脚本,可实现更复杂的逻辑。例如,编写脚本自动在晚高峰切换至备用节点,或根据当前运行的应用(如Zotero、MATLAB)决定是否启用代理。

5.3 日志分析与问题排查

当访问异常时,打开日志页面(通常显示为实时滚动的请求记录)。你会看到类似2023-10-01 10:23:45 [INFO] [Google] match Rule using 智能选择的信息。通过它,你可以确认规则是否生效、节点是否健康,甚至发现某些应用的后台连接行为。

5.4 多设备同步配置

使用配置托管服务(如GitHub Gist)将配置文件存储在云端,然后在手机(Clash for Android、Stash for iOS)和电脑上同步引用。这样,无论在实验室、宿舍还是图书馆,你的网络环境始终一致。

六、常见问题深度解析

问:配置后部分校内网站无法访问?
答:这通常是规则冲突导致。检查是否将校内IP段或域名误设为代理。建议使用IP-CIDR规则将校园网IP段(如10.0.0.0/8172.16.0.0/12)强制直连。

问:使用Clash后网速明显下降?
答:首先在关闭Clash时测试基线网速。若问题确由Clash引起,可能原因包括:节点负载过高(尝试切换其他节点)、DNS解析慢(在配置中改用114.114.114.114等国内DNS)、规则过于复杂(简化规则链)。校园网高峰时段,国际出口本身拥堵也难以避免。

问:如何平衡安全与性能?
答:避免使用来源不明的公共节点;定期更新配置文件中的节点信息;启用Clash的tun-mode(透明代理)可减少系统层面的暴露;重要账号访问尽量走直连。

问:Clash会影响在线课堂或考试系统吗?
答:如果正确配置,应该不会。但为保险起见,参加重要在线考试前可临时关闭Clash,或为考试平台设置独立直连规则。有些监考软件会检测代理工具,需提前了解相关规定。

七、超越技术:理性使用与数字公民意识

Clash提供的网络自由伴随责任。在校园中使用时,应坚守学术伦理:不用于批量下载受版权保护的资料,不访问违法信息,不干扰校园网正常运营。同时,理解工具背后的网络原理,比单纯“能用”更重要——这本身就是数字时代的重要素养。

许多计算机相关专业的学生,通过配置Clash深入理解了网络协议栈、路由决策、加密通信等概念。更有甚者,开始贡献自己的规则集、编写辅助工具回馈社区。这种从“使用者”到“建设者”的转变,或许是Clash带来的最深层价值。

语言艺术点评

纵观全文,这篇教程在语言上实现了多重平衡:技术精确性与叙述流畅性的平衡——既严谨解释YAML语法结构,又以“网络地图”、“交通分流”等比喻降低理解门槛;功能指导与理念传达的平衡——不止步于操作步骤,更探讨工具背后的网络哲学与使用伦理;结构规范与阅读节奏的平衡——通过模块化标题清晰分层,同时段落内部保持自然推进,避免机械罗列。

尤为出色的是贯穿全文的场景化叙事。将Clash配置嵌入“图书馆查阅-实验室协作-宿舍自学”的校园生活流中,使冰冷的技术指南焕发出人文温度。在FAQ部分,采用“问题-原因-解决方案”的递进式回答,体现了对读者认知逻辑的尊重。

文字间隐约透露出一种学院派的优雅与开源社区的务实相结合的气质:既有“数字素养”、“网络拓扑”等学术词汇的恰当使用,又不乏“一键切换”、“实时滚动”等直观表达。结尾部分升华至“数字公民意识”,将工具教程提升至育人层面,体现了作者深层的写作意图——技术传授最终服务于人的成长。

这种写作风格,恰如Clash本身:在规则与自由之间寻找优雅的平衡,在功能与理念之间构建坚实的桥梁,最终指向一个更高效、更明智、更负责任的信息使用未来。